The multi-tenant office building is located in Trachenbergring in Berlin-Marienfelde within a mixed commercial/residential area in the district of Tempelhof-Schöneberg. The multifunctional office building has space to host up to 30 tenants. It has 70 parking spots in an underground parking garage and 74 parking spots outside the building. The building has been acquired in an off-market deal.

The property was initially built in 1992 by Sony and used for themselves. The rentable space is approx. 8.770 sqm and has material value-add potential. The acquisition price is approximately EUR 18 million.
